清洗画布并重新绘制是指在前端开发中,通过操作画布元素,清除已有的绘制内容,并重新绘制新的图形或图像。下面是一个完善且全面的答案:
清洗画布并重新绘制的步骤如下:
document.getElementById()
方法或其他选择器方法来获取。getContext()
方法来获取2D绘图上下文,例如:var ctx = canvas.getContext('2d');
。这里使用的是2D绘图上下文,也可以使用WebGL等其他上下文进行3D绘制。clearRect()
方法来清除画布上的内容。该方法接受四个参数,分别是清除区域的起始点坐标和宽高。例如,ctx.clearRect(0, 0, canvas.width, canvas.height);
可以清除整个画布。fillRect()
方法绘制矩形,drawImage()
方法绘制图像,beginPath()
和lineTo()
方法绘制路径等。具体绘制的内容和方式根据需求而定。清洗画布并重新绘制的应用场景包括但不限于:
腾讯云相关产品和产品介绍链接地址:
腾讯云提供了一系列与云计算相关的产品和服务,包括云服务器、云数据库、云存储等。以下是一些相关产品和对应的介绍链接地址:
请注意,以上链接仅供参考,具体产品选择应根据实际需求进行评估和决策。
领取专属 10元无门槛券
手把手带您无忧上云